Output f893688094cc266ac205741fcdf81acb9069bbbf145e5c46e440cfd0f775c618:22

value
64035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24ba772163fe84d73549b5b98898ec2a2a8da3f2 OP_EQUAL
address
353DdHkDEnPCMZ7zv69FHfMy4a9qW4ZqPx
transaction
f893688094cc266ac205741fcdf81acb9069bbbf145e5c46e440cfd0f775c618
spent
true